Fuel crisis: DPR reads riot act to oil marketers

Obviously in response to the lingering fuel crisis and the loud complaints by suffering consumers, the management of the Department of Petroleum Resources, DPR, may have decided that enough was enough. And to demonstrate its feeling in this regard, it has warned all petroleum products marketers that it would not hesitate to commensurately sanction those who indulge in varying despicable acts in the procurement and distribution of petroleum products.

Ministerial committee recommends scrapping of DG

There are strong indications that the Ministry of Youth and Sports has concluded plans to scrap the office of the Director General of the ministry.
Source at the ministry told Sports Vanguard that the committee set up by the Permanent Secretary, Christian Ohaa to look into how to harmonise the operations of the ministry and those of the Sports Commission recommended that other directors be retained except the office of the Director General, currently occupied by Alhassan Yakmut.
